Good Afternoon ACGC Families,
ACGC Public Schools will be joining school districts and charter schools across the state to create plans to equitably distribute distance learning to our students should we need to close schools statewide for a longer period of time due to the COVID-19 pandemic. The Minnesota Department of Education is defining distance learning to mean that a student receives daily interaction with their licensed teacher(s) and appropriate educational materials.
- Effective Immediately ACGC Public Schools are Closed from March 15, 2020- March 27, 2020
- No school for students on Tuesday, March 17, 2020
- No school sponsored activities, including Community Education courses, starting Sunday, March 15, 2020
- ACGC Kids are Great Daycare/School Aged Childcare is open for students currently enrolled in daycare as well as children of emergency workers (including providers of healthcare, emergency medical services, long-term and post-acute care; law enforcement personnel; personnel providing correctional services; public health employees; firefighters and other first responders; and court personnel) are critical to the State’s response to COVID-19
- ACGC Staff: All staff report to their building on Tuesday, March 17, 2020
- Staff in at-risk categories should take action consistent with public health recommendations or the advice of their doctors.
